6th November 2014
Artistic Director of the Octagon Theatre, Bolton, DAVID THACKER is to become the first Professor of Theatre at the University of Bolton, leading its new BA (Hons) degree in Theatre. The theatre and university will be working closely, and Thacker will remain at the Octagon as Associate Artistic Director until 2018.
JANICE HOSEGOOD has been appointed as the new Head of Communications at Cockpit Arts, the creative business incubator for designer-makers. Currently Manager of Ruberg Jewellery in London, Hosegood will continue to run the freelance arts consultancy that she set up in 2007.
Senior Publicist for Albion Media, NAOMI BURGOYNE is stepping down after two years in post to cover maternity leave for LIBBY BINKS, Press Manager for Classical Music at the Southbank Centre.
30th October 2014
Chief Executive of Luton Culture, MAGGIE APPLETON MBE, is stepping down after six years in post to take up the position of CEO at the Royal Air Force Museum. Appleton is also a Heritage Lottery Fund committee member for the East of England and a board member for the Museums Association.
After nine years as Director of Stratford Circus, CLARE CONNOR is stepping down to become Director of Business Development at the Southbank Centre.
JASON WOOD is leaving Curzon, where he has been Director of Programming for five years, to become Artistic Director: Film at Manchester’s new art centre HOME.
The new Producer for English Touring Theatre is JAMES QUAIFE. His recent productions include Next Fall at the Southwark Playhouse and Good People at the Noel Coward Theatre.
Manchester Camerata has appointed three new board members: Chief Executive of the Commission for the New Economy MIKE EMMERICH; Partner, Transaction Advisory Services at EY (formerly Ernst and Young), RICHARD HARDING; and ANDY SPINOZA, Managing Director of PR agency SKV Communications.
The Interim CEO of Poet in the City, ISOBEL COLCHESTER, will remain on permanently in the role. She has been associated with the organisation for more than five years.
